Ordinals
beta
Address 18BBjsrmTQFhTvYkJEYmU1zsNCPem4FNTk
sat balance
37706
outputs
f2d033835b39b2261d5e56f5e5b00c2d7c61778c8d1f95d04978c4bef3184db0:1